Title :
Generalization of the cyclic convolution system and its applications

Abstract :
This paper introduces a generalized cyclic convolution which can be implemented via the conventional cyclic convolution system by the discrete Fourier transform (DFT) with pre-multiplication for the input and post-multiplication for the output. The generalized cyclic convolution is applied for computing a negacyclic convolution. Comparison shows that the proposed implementation is more efficient and simpler in structure than other methods. The generalized cyclic convolution is also applied for the linear convolution by the modified Fermat number transform
